Mix/Combine/Whisk together the dry ingredients in a large bowl. In a/another bowl, cream/beat/whisk the butter/vegetable oil and sugar until light/fluffy. Add the eggs one at a time/each egg individually, followed by the vanilla extract.

Gradually/Slowly add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, mixing until just combined/blended. Stir in the mashed bananas until/until well incorporated.

Pour the batter into a greased and floured loaf pan. Bake/Roast in a preheated oven at 350 degrees Fahrenheit/175 degrees Celsius for 50-60 minutes, or until a wooden skewer inserted into the center comes out clean.

Let the bread cool in the pan for 10-15 minutes before transferring it to a wire rack to cool completely.

  • The browner the bananas, the better the bread!
  • Don't overmix the batter!
  • Patience is key! Let it cool in the pan for 10 minutes, then on a wire rack to prevent crumbling.
